Output 8415cf58178519c5c6aec3f579c81730a2a75ae57e70e8dcc221cb07e2100914:0

value
19000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 cd10d1dae872e5fb00479b9796bfe66b197a50d6 OP_EQUALVERIFY OP_CHECKSIG
address
1KhHfywUqYaeJULi1DYcPf42bceZL25JvE
transaction
8415cf58178519c5c6aec3f579c81730a2a75ae57e70e8dcc221cb07e2100914
spent
true